Church & Oswaldtwistle station doesn't have a staffed ticket office, but you're not left in the lurch. Ticket machines are on hand for collecting tickets purchased online, but do note that they aren't accessible for everyone. Assistance at the station is limited, but help can be requested by using the customer help points available or by reaching out via their helpline. Passenger safety is prioritized with CCTV in operation throughout the station. There are seating areas at the station to cater to waiting passengers, though there are no waiting rooms available.
Fully equipped for the basics, the station lacks certain facilities—you won't find any refreshment stalls, ATMs, or shops. Therefore, it's best to prepare ahead before arriving. There are also no toilets, baby-changing facilities, or car parks available. However, for those interested in cycling, keep in mind that there’s no bike storage at this station as well.
Accessibility is a key concern at Church & Oswaldtwistle. While step-free access is possible on one side via a lengthy ramp, accessing the other platform requires navigating steps. If mobility assistance is needed, you might want to tap into the national Passenger Assist service before your journey. While the station might not be the most equipped in terms of accessibility, ramps are available for train access. Further information can be found by checking out the station's 360-degree map.

Cadoxton Train Station is equipped with essential facilities to facilitate a smooth travel experience. While there is no waiting room, travelers can enjoy the comfort of a seating area on the platform. The station features a ticket office with limited weekday hours from 06:00 to 10:30 but offers ticket machines that are accessible and card-only for convenience. Additionally, smartcard validators are present, although smartcards are not issued at this location.
Accessibility is a key feature, with full step-free access available throughout the station, accommodating wheelchairs and providing a seamless journey from entrance to train. However, amenities such as toilets, baby changing facilities, refreshment services, and public Wi-Fi are absent, making it a necessity for travelers to plan ahead.
Security is ensured with CCTV coverage, but it’s important to note the lack of a designated luggage storage area. In the unlikely event of a lost item, services for lost property are managed through Transport for Wales.
